E-CR Flange Rubber Expansion Joint for Flexible Piping Connections
This flexible connector is engineered for versatile use in demanding industrial environments, ensuring reliable performance in the transport of cold and hot water (excluding drinking water), seawater, treated cooling water, municipal wastewater, oil-contaminated water, and compressed air at non-elevated temperatures. Constructed with a durable CR rubber (chloroprene) inner and outer layer, reinforced with a high-strength nylon cord, it delivers excellent resistance to wear, pressure, and environmental factors. The flanges, made of galvanized carbon steel, provide secure and long-lasting connections, even under intensive operating conditions. Designed to operate within a wide temperature range from -25°C to +90°C, with short-term resistance up to +100°C depending on the medium, this solution offers outstanding flexibility and durability. Marked with the CR designation on the sleeve, it guarantees easy identification and compliance with technical standards. Not suitable for hydrocarbons, acids, or bases, this product is the ideal choice for industries seeking a safe, efficient, and cost-effective solution for fluid and air transfer applications.
